Abstract
A turbine blade for use in a gas turbine engine, where the turbine blade is made from a spar and shell construction in which a thin walled shell is held in place between the blade tip and the platform by only a mechanical fastener without using any bonding, welding or brazing. The spar is connected to an attachment by a tie bolt, and a separate platform is secured, over the attachment t in which the shell is held against. This provides for a thermally free platform and shell connection. With this arrangement, the shell is held under compression within the 2% yield stress range such that the turbine blade shell can have an infinite life. Also, the turbine blade is much lighter than prior art blades. As a result, the spar and shell blade produces less stress on the rotor disk during engine operation.
